Current methods of diagnosis and treatment for limbal stem cell deficiency (review)

Year: 2022, volume 18 Issue: №3 Pages: 309-314
Heading: Ophthalmology Article type: Review
Authors: Yu. Ya., Andreev A.Yu., Voronin G.V., Ibragimova R.R.
Organization: Research Institute of Eye Diseases, First Moscow State Medical University n.a. I.M. Sechenov
Summary:

Objective: analysis of modern methods of diagnosis of limbal stem cell deficiency (LSCD), assessment of advantages and disadvantages of surgical methods of its treatment. LSCD is a difficuIt-to-treat pathology of the ocular surface. Currently, there are both therapeutic and surgical techniques aimed at combating this problem. We have analyzed more than 50 research papers with a detailed consideration of the current diagnostic criteria and the main advantages and disadvantages of surgical approaches to LSCD, published in 1986-2020 and distributed in eLibrary, PubMed, ResearchGate. However, recently on the wave of active development of tissue-engineering technology and regenerative medicine, tissue and cell transplantation are becoming a new treatment strategy for this disease. In addition, with the application of newly developed ocular imaging technology and molecular methods, diagnose LSCD becomes more reliable. The analysis revealed that among all surgical methods, transplantation of cultured limbal stem cells is the most promising method of treating LSCD.

Development a "Quality of Life" (QoL) questionnaire for a patient in cataract surgery based on an expert assessment by ophthalmologists

Year: 2022, volume 18 Issue: №3 Pages: 301-304
Heading: Ophthalmology Article type: Original article
Authors: Ovechkin N.I., Pavlov A.I., Ovechkin I.G., Pokrovsky D.F.
Organization: Helmholtz National Medical Research Center of Eye Diseases, Federal Research and Clinical Center of Specialized Types of Medical Care and Medical Technologies, Academy of Postgraduate Education, Moscow State University of Food Production, Russian Research Medical University n. a. N.I. Pirogov
Summary:

Objective: development a "Quality of Life" (QoL) questionnaire for a patient in cataract surgery based on an expert assessment by ophthalmologists. Material and methods. As part of the preliminary stage of work, based on the results of a patient survey, as well as an analysis of the literature data, the initial volume of patient complaints was formed before and after cataract phacoemulsification (PEC), which were transformed into questions (a total of 52 questions). The study was performed with the participation of 47 expert ophthalmologists with professional experience from 7 to 35 years (average 19.2±1.4 years), including experience in performing PEC from 1 to 24 years (average 11.9±1.7 years). The task of the expert was to assess the relevance of each of the questions from the standpoint of the degree of influence on the patient's QoL. At the same time, the assessment was performed on a 10-point scale, according to which 0 points —the question is not relevant; 10 points —the question is very relevant. Results. Analysis of the results included: statistical processing of experts' answers on each of the questions; development of the initial version of the questionnaire (according to the Pareto method), as a result of which 28 (out of 42) most relevant questions were identified); association of similar clinical questions and statistical assessment of the validation (acceptability) of the association. The final version of the questionnaire includes 22 questions. Conclusion. The developed questionnaire fully complies with the requirements of meaningful and constructive validity.

Contribution of Professor Nikolai Kolosov to the development of neurohistol-ogy (to the 125th birth anniversary)

Year: 2022, volume 18 Issue: №2 Pages: 286-289
Heading: Scientific schools, commemorative dates Article type:
Authors: Petrov V.V., Zavyalov A.I., Kovalenko Yu.V.
Organization: Saratov State Medical University
Summary:

The article is devoted to the research, pedagogical and social activities of one of the prominent Russian histologists of our country of the twentieth century, Professor N.G. Kolosov, a corresponding member of the Academy of Sciences of the USSR and the Academy of Medical Sciences of the USSR, who made a significant contribution to the development of national neuromorphology. From 1945 to 1950, Professor N.G. Kolosov headed the Department of Histology and Embryology of the Saratov State Medical Institute. In a relatively short period of his activity at the Saratov Medical Institute, he managed to lay the foundations of the neuromorphological direction of the Department of Histology, establish a close relationship with the staff of clinics and involve them in research activities.

Peculiarities of microcirculatory reactions in the area of experimental wound defect in white rats

Year: 2022, volume 18 Issue: №2 Pages: 272-275
Heading: Рathophysiology Article type: Original article
Authors: Loyko D.D., Savkina А.А., Stepanova T.V., Kiriiazi T.S., Osnovin O.V., Andronova Т.А., Abdrahmanova I.I., Fedorov A.N., Ivanov A.N.
Organization: Saratov State Medical University
Summary:

Objective: to reveal changes of microbloodflow parameters by the laser Doppler flowmetry method in the process of wound defect healing and possibility of their application to modernization of the technologies forwound healing agents effectiveness evaluating. Material and methods. The studies were carried out on 25 white rats divided into 2 groups: 10 control intact rats, 15 animals with a full-thickness experimental skin defect. The microcirculatory parameters of the wound skin edges in rats were evaluated with laser Doppler flowmetry. Histological assay of the wound defect tissues were also performed. Results. It was established that changes in skin microcirculation at the wound defect edges were characterized by inflammatory hyperemia, which was manifested by 27% perfusion increase and increase of normalized amplitudes of myogenic, respiratory and cardiac oscillations. Changes in microcirculation are verified by the morphological picture of inflammation, which reflects an increase in the number of full-blooded vessels of the arterial and venous bed, as well as leukocyte infiltration of the bottom and edges of the wound. Conclusion. Monitoring of microcirculatory disorders occurring in the area of skin wounds allows us to assess the dynamics of the reparative process, which can be used to develop and evaluate the effectiveness of existing drug and non-drug methods of stimulating regeneration.

The anatomical characteristic of the lower jaw of human fetuses in the second trimester

Year: 2022, volume 18 Issue: №2 Pages: 266-271
Heading: Human anatomy Article type: Original article
Authors: Neprokina A.V., Lutsay E.D., Vinidictova M.A.
Organization: Orenburg Regional Clinical Hospital №2, Orenburg State Medical University
Summary:

Objective: to reveal the features of anatomical structure of the lower jaw of fetuses of second trimester. Material and methods. The lower jaw of 45 human male and female fetuses of the second trimester has been researched using the method of ultrasound scanning and using the morphological techniques: morphometry and macromicroscopic preparation. Results. The average length of the alveolar arch was 64.1 ±3.6 mm, the average angular width was 30.2±4.0 mm, the average projection length was 24.8±3.5 mm, the average height of branch was 21.1±3.1 mm, the average smallest width of branch was 12.2±1.3 mm. The angle of the lower jaw was equal to an average of 127.2±9.8° with a range of values: from 115 to 156°. According to the long-latitudinal index (LLI) the fetuses had two forms: mesomandibular (39%) and leptomandibular (61%). The shape of the branch of all lower jaws according to the latitude-altitudinal index (LAI) was platyramimandibular. The significant gender differences for the mandibular angle, projection length, angular width (p=0.026; 0.046; 0.039, respectively) were found. The female fetuses were dominated by the angle and projection length, while the male fetuses were dominated by the angular width. Conclusion. Features of the anatomical structure of the lower jaw in the fruits of the second trimester were revealed normally. The data about anatomical structure of the lower jaw of fetuses of second trimester are normally interested for supplement fundamental knowledge about its development in a given age period and has an applied importance forthe detection of congenital malformations, including the use of intravital imaging methods.

Social and role determination of professional communication in medicine

Year: 2022, volume 18 Issue: №2 Pages: 260-265
Heading: Sociology and history of medicine Article type: Original article
Authors: Chernyshkova E.V., Katkova A.V., Andriyanov S.V., Chernyshkov D.V., Meshcheriakova I.Yu., Kuznetsova M.N., Andriyanova E.A.
Organization: Centre of Medical-Sociological Research, Saratov State Medical University
Summary:

Objective: to define influence of patient's expectations and physician's role behavior on character and satisfaction with communicative process. Material and methods. The survey of physicians (Л/=232) and patients (Л/=255) was carried out by means of the authorized questionnaires. The questionnaire for doctors was aimed to identify segments of a doctor's professional activity in terms of fulfilling a given social role. The questionnaire for patients made it possible to obtain data on how stable ideas about the "titular" professional qualities of a doctor influence the nature of communication in therapeutic process. Results. It was revealed that the effectiveness of communication process between a physician and a patient was determined by: trust in doctors (88.2%); high stress level of practitioners (69.4%); time allotted for patient's reception (51.7%); level of patient's perception of medical information (42%). The predominantly conflict-free course of the communicative process is noted (62.7%). The most attractive qualities of a physician from patients'viewpoint were described: clarity and completeness of provided information (100%); respectful assessment of personality (62.7%); conflict-free (62.7%); tolerance (74.5%); openness (62.7%); support (62.7%). Conclusion. There were differences in choosing the model of interaction between a physician and a patient. Increase of practitioners' status as a condition and consequence of communication with patients was differentiated by physicians as a need for legal protection of professional activity, a decent pension, an enhance of doctor's professional prestige, and an improvement of working conditions; patients determined it as physicians' adherence to ethical standards in communicating with patients, increase of doctor's professionalism.

Medical and sociological analysis of the quality of life in rural physicians

Year: 2022, volume 18 Issue: №2 Pages: 256-260
Heading: Sociology and history of medicine Article type: Original article
Authors: Krom I.L., Erugina M.V., Eremina М.G., Sapogova M.D., Subbotina V.G.
Organization: Saratov State Medical University
Summary:

Objective: to analyze the quality of life of rural healthcare doctors in the Saratov region. Material and methods. 327 doctors working in regional medical organizations of the Saratov region took part in the survey. The respondents' quality of life was assessed using the Russian-language version of WHOQOL-100 (World Health Organization Quality of Life questionnaire with 100 items). Results. The lowest values of the respondents' average quality of life indicators were recorded in the sub-sphere F18 "Financial resources" (10.19±1.20). The highest values of the respondents' average quality of life indicators were established in the sub-spheres: F9 "Mobility" (16.26±1.24), F12 "Ability to work" (16.06±0.90) and F13 "Personal relations" (16.26±0.81). There were no significant gender and age differences in the quality of life of the respondents (p>0.05). Conclusion. An analysis of the quality of life of doctors in rural health care in the Saratov region revealed a decrease in its indicators in all areas and sub-spheres of the WHOQOL-100. The results of the study prove the impact on the quality of life of rural healthcare doctors of their professional activities and living conditions in rural areas.
